Mooloo is a rural locality in the Gympie Region, Queensland, Australia. [2] In the 2021 census, Mooloo had a population of 171 people. [1]

Contents

History

Mooloo Provisional School opened in 1919. In 1922, it became Mooloo State School. It closed on 10 August 1962. [3] It was at approx 712 Mooloo Road ( 26°18′07″S152°36′32″E / 26.3019°S 152.6089°E / -26.3019; 152.6089 (Mooloo State School (former)) ). [4] [5]

Demographics

In the 2016 census Mooloo had a population of 146 people. [6]

In the 2021 census, Mooloo had a population of 171 people. [1]
